Full DV



The basic requirement for this level of editing is a DV camcorder, a suitably powerful computer with plenty of hard drive space, plenty of memory and a Fire Wire (IEEE 1394) port or capture card. You will also need software capable of importing DV encoded video footage to allow editing and manipulation.

You will also need a means by which to publish or copy the material either to VHS tape, back to a MiniDV tape or onto DVD or CD.

It is very useful to have a camera that can import edited video back from the computer. For this it will need a DV in facility as well as DV out. Without this functionality it is very difficult to make full quality back-ups of the finished video.
